‘Stop blame game’: Rajasthan LoP hits out at BJP govt over LPG ‘crunch’

Jaipur, Mar 14 (PTI) Leader of Opposition in the Rajasthan Assembly Tikaram Jully on Saturday alleged that people are facing difficulties due to cooking gas shortage, but the government is wasting its energy in targeting the Congress instead of resolving the issues.

He urged the government to stop the “blame game” and immediately take steps to improve the supply system and initiate strict action against black marketing of LPG cylinders.

“If the BJP government had focused on tackling black marketing and administrative lapses rather than political confrontation, women, labourers, auto drivers and small vendors would not have faced such hardship,” he said.
